Non-linear correlations based on mutual information are evaluated to measure statistical dependencies among data points measured from metabolism in two dimensional space. While the Pearson correlation coefficient is only rigorously applicable to characterize strictly linear correlations with Gaussian noise, the mutual information coefficient is more generally valid.
